After an initial evaluation of the child’s motor function, we’ll design fun exercises and activities that help build necessary skills. Therapists often use colorful equipment, obstacle courses, and games to make sessions engaging and goal-oriented. As your child progresses, we’ll regularly assess their development and adjust activities to maintain the right level of challenge. We’ll also provide home-based exercises or suggestions for playtime activities that reinforce therapy goals. Because consistency is key, we encourage family involvement to keep the child supported and motivated both inside and outside our clinic setting.
Children with orthopedic conditions, developmental delays, neurological disorders, or sports-related injuries. Pediatric Physical Therapy also benefits kids recovering from surgeries or dealing with chronic conditions like cerebral palsy. What age groups does pediatric physical therapy cover?
We work with infants to teenagers, adapting methods to their developmental stage.
Can PT help my child who has trouble walking?
Yes. We use specific strengthening and coordination exercises to improve gait and mobility.
How can I encourage my child to cooperate with therapy?
We make sessions playful and engaging, and we encourage parental involvement for support and motivation.
Is therapy painful for children?
We aim to make exercises comfortable and fun; if any discomfort arises, we adjust activities accordingly.
How long does a pediatric PT session last?
Sessions often range from 30 to 60 minutes, based on the child’s age and attention span.
What if my child also needs speech or occupational therapy?
We can coordinate care with speech and occupational therapists for a multidisciplinary approach.
Will my child receive home exercises?
Yes. Simple activities and games to practice at home can reinforce progress made in therapy.
